Sat 1303470802414185

decimal
311388.802414185
degree
0°101388′924″802414185‴
percentile
62.07003827847636%
name
eprguecqeqa
cycle
0
epoch
1
period
154
block
311388
offset
802414185
timestamp
rarity
common